GLBT Historical Society Presents an A Discussion with the Author of “The Einstein of Sex” Daniel Brook December 11

Gary Carnivele December 4, 2025

AUTHOR TALK
THE EINSTEIN OF SEX
Thursday, December 11 | 6:00pm
GLBT Historical Society Musuem
Over a century ago, Dr. Magnus Hirschfeld — the “Einstein of Sex” — revolutionized how we understand gender and sexuality. Nearly 100 years after the Nazis burned his books and destroyed his institute, his vision of fluid, expansive identity remains powerfully relevant.

Join the GLBT Historical Society for an Author Talk & Book Signing with journalist Daniel Brook, in conversation with historian and Society founding member Gerard Koskovich. Brook will share new insights from Hirschfeld’s 1931 Bay Area visit, including his tour of San Quentin and his advocacy for Black transgender inmates targeted by discriminatory laws.
